Suspects still sought in assault on woman
Police continue to search for suspects in the investigation of the past weekend's sexual assault and abduction of a 41-year-old Collinsville woman from a parking lot by two men.
Collinsville Police Chief Scott Williams said police are seeking the public's assistance in this case.
'We are hoping for anyone who might have information to call us,' Williams said.
The victim told police she had gotten out of her vehicle to check something in a parking lot in the 700 block of St. Louis Road about 7:30 p.m. Sunday. She was then confronted, beaten and forced back into her vehicle by two Spanish-speaking males, who sexually assaulted her, according to Collinsville Police. Read more
